This book is a wonderful read for both young readers and adults alike. It educated the young children about the World War II, especially about women who took part in the war. The central character in the story, Charlotte Wheeler was one of the Women air force service pilots in WW2 , she flew planes to transport them to a military base. The story is centered around a mystery involving a crashed plane and its missing pilot. The NCIS finds a note in the crashed plane, which traces it to charlotte wheeler and her family members. When Annie’s mother gets a call from the NCIS, Annie, who is about to go to college, tries to solve the mystery and learns about the women who served during WW2. Annie and her mother, find more letters in the attic and she, along with her boyfriend Ty, try to solve the pieces of the puzzle together with the resources available to them, and succeed eventually.
It is a very cool mystery and both young and old alike can enjoy this book. I am thinking of introducing this book to my young readers at home as well. This is the fourth in the Annie Tillary series, I have not read the first three. I now look forward to read the remaining books of the series.

This is the 4th book in the Empire At Twilight series and the books keep getting better. What I love about this author is how they are able to bring history to life. The stories are enjoyable to read and the author knowledge about historical times really brings the story and characters to life.
Tudhaliya IV has taken the throne of the Hittite Empire after his father passes away. He is placed in that position over all of his older half brothers and he wonders why.
Knowing that it isn’t his rightful role he struggles to keep everyone happy and his relationships with his family members on the right track. However with his best friend and cousin the rightful person to take the throne,Tudhaliya is torn between his loyalty to his family and dear friend and his duty to the throne. Add to this story the forces working against him and he doesn’t know who to trust. Should we just trust people because they are family or should he be guarded against everyone and anyone.
